SQLite内连接(inner join)是最常见的连接类型。 它用于组合满足连接条件的多个表中的所有行记录。 SQlite内连接是默认的连接类型。 语法: SELECT ... FROM table1 [INNER] …
标签:SQLite教程
SQLite连接(JOIN子句)
在SQLite中,JOIN子句用于组合数据库中两个或多个表的记录。 它通过使用两个表的公共值来组合来自两个表的字段。 SQLite中主要有三种类型的连接: SQLite内连接 SQLite外连接 SQLite交叉连接 示…
SQLite IN运算符
SQLite IN运算符用于确定值是否匹配列表或子查询中的任何值。 IN运算符的语法如下: expression [NOT] IN (value_list|subquery); expression可以是任何有效的表达式…
SQLite Union All操作符
SQLite UNION ALL运算符用于组合两个或多个SELECT语句的结果,但是不忽略重复的行(含有重复的行记录)。 在SQLite UNION ALL中,查询结果表还包括重复值。 其它规则适用于Union操作符。 …
SQLite Union操作符
SQLite UNION运算符用于使用SELECT语句组合两个或多个表的结果集。 UNION操作符仅显示唯一的行(删除重复的行)。 在使用UNION运算符时,每个SELECT语句必须在结果集中具有相同数量的字段。 语法:…
SQLite DISTINCT子句
SQLite DISTINCT子句与SELECT语句一起使用,用来消除所有重复记录,并仅获取唯一记录。 当在表中有多个重复记录时可使用它来过滤重复的记录。 语法: SELECT DISTINCT column1, col…
SQLite HAVING子句
SQLite HAVING子句用于指定过滤分组的结果,并作为最终查询结果的条件。 WHERE子句将条件放在选定的列上,而HAVING子句指定的条件是由GROUP BY子句创建的列分组上(使用HAVING子句条件一定要作用…
SQLite GROUP BY子句
SQLite GROUP BY子句与SELECT语句一起使用,将相同的相同元素合并成一个组。 GROUP BY子句与SELECT语句中的WHERE子句一起使用,并且WHERE子句在ORDER BY子句之前。 语法: SE…
SQLite ORDER BY子句
SQLite ORDER BY子句用于根据一个或多个列对所获取的数据按升序或降序进行排序(排序)。 语法 SELECT column-list FROM table_name [WHERE condition] [ORD…
SQLite LIMIT子句
SQLite LIMIT子句用于限制通过SELECT命令从表中获取的记录的数量。 语法: SELECT column1, column2, columnN FROM table_name LIMIT [no of row…
SQLite GLOB子句
SQLite GLOB操作符通过使用通配符将模式表达式与文本值匹配, 当搜索表达式与模式表达式匹配时,GLOB运算符将返回真,该值为:1。 GLOB运算符遵循UNIX的语法,使用指定以下通配符。 星号(*): 符号表示零…
SQLite LIKE子句
SQLite LIKE运算符用于使用通配符将文本值与模式进行匹配。 在搜索表达式与模式表达式匹配的情况下,LIKE运算符将返回真,即:1。 与LIKE操作符一起使用的两个通配符: 百分号(%) 下划线(_) 百分号(%)…